Primary Responsibilities

Patient care involves assisting with daily activities like bathing, dressing, grooming, and toileting. Helping patients with mobility, such as turning, repositioning, and transferring between beds and wheelchairs, is also a key part of the role. Additionally, serving meals and assisting with feeding if needed is required.

Vital signs monitoring includes taking and recording vital signs such as temperature, blood pressure, pulse, and respiration rate, and reporting any changes in a patient’s condition to nurses or doctors.

Support for nurses and doctors involves setting up medical equipment and assisting during some procedures, transporting patients to different departments, restocking supplies, and maintaining a clean, safe environment.

Patient observation requires monitoring patients for signs of distress or changes in behavior, documenting care provided, and communicating observations to the healthcare team.

Emotional support involves offering companionship and reassurance to patients, and communicating with patients’ families to help them understand care routines.

Work Environment

This role may be different for those who have never worked in a hospital due to the fast-paced, often high-pressure environment. Patients may be acutely ill or recovering from surgery, and patient turnover is high. The duties involve assisting with post-operative care, monitoring vital signs frequently, supporting nurses during procedures, and transporting patients to tests or surgeries.

CNAs work closely with a large, multidisciplinary team including RNs, doctors, and specialists, and may be exposed to different departments and diverse experiences.
